Web.HTTPApp.TWebResponse

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

System.TObjectTWebResponse

Delphi

TWebResponse = class(TObject)

C++

class PASCALIMPLEMENTATION TWebResponse : public System::TObject

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
class public
Web.HTTPApp.pas
Web.HTTPApp.hpp
Web.HTTPApp Web.HTTPApp

Beschreibung

TWebResponse ist die Basisklasse für alle Objekte, die für HTTP-Botschaften eingesetzt werden, die als Antwort auf eine HTTP-Anforderung gesendet werden.

Mit von TWebResponse abgeleiteten Klassen können Sie die Antwort auf eine HTTP-Anforderung festlegen.

Die Web-Anwendung erzeugt für jedes TWebRequest-Objekt, das eine von einem Web-Client eingehende Anforderung repräsentiert, ein entsprechendes TWebResponse-Objekt. Der Web-Dispatcher der Anwendung gibt das TWebResponse-Objekt anschließend an das TWebActionItem-Objekt weiter, das mit dem TWebRequest-Objekt verknüpft ist. Das TWebActionItem-Objekt setzt dann die Antwort zusammen.

Die Klasse TWebResponse hat Nachkommen, die HTTP-Antworten für verschiedene Arten von Web-Server-Anwendungen repräsentieren: Diese Nachkommen sind:

  • TApacheResponse-Objekte in Apache-Server-Anwendungen.
  • TCGIResponse-Objekte für CGI-Server-Anwendungen.
  • TISAPIResponse-Objekte in Server-DLLs (nur Windows).
  • TWinCGIResponse-Objekte in Windows-basierten CGI-Servern (nur Windows).

Siehe auch